Hospital organizational context and delivery of evidence-based stroke care: a cross-sectional study
Abstract
Organizational context is one factor influencing the translation of evidence into practice, but data pertaining to patients with acute stroke are limited. We aimed to determine the associations of organizational context in relation to four important evidence-based stroke care processes. This was a mixed methods cross-sectional study.
